Mobile World Congress is rapidly approaching in Barcelona on the 11th till 14th February 2008. Even though this exhibition leans heavily towards the services side, their are many manufacturers of equipment and components that come over all over the world to present their latest innovations. One key theme that will be of particular interest will be WiMAX. There is a lot of noise surrounding this emerging technology as well as emerging competition in the form of LTE (Long Term Evolution). WiMAX is the scruffy upstart that threatens to steal the show and cash from the incumbent mobile companies. It is looking to deliver broadband wireless everywhere and is not fussy about business models as long as they work. Mobile phone operators on the other hand are looking to protect their positions and investments in 3G technology, which they are continuously enhancing. However, at one point the legacy needs to go and hence LTE, which in essence is the same technology as WiMAX, just a different set of standards and vested interests. Hopefully, after Barcelona we will see what progress WiMAX has made and if LTE is managing to close the gap. Will the WiMAX lead narrow. Who will win depends a lot on WiMAX deploying rapidly.
